site stats

Pd merge pandas on index

SpletFor this, we have to specify the how argument within the merge function to be equal to “outer”. Besides this, we can use the same syntax as in Example 1 to add our two … Splet29. okt. 2024 · The generalization of this approach is obtained by combining 2 functions (INDEX and MATCH) in order to be able to append new columns to a dataset, using any column as a common key (regardless...

How to Merge Two DataFrames on Index in Pandas - Data Science …

Splet13. okt. 2024 · pd.merge는 공통의 열을 기준으로 두 데이터프레임을 합쳐준다. sql에서 join과 같은 역할이다. import pandas as pd # 기준열 이름이 같을 때 pd.merge (left, right, on = '기준열', how = '조인방식' ) # 기준열 이름이 다를 때 pd.merge (left, right, left_on = '왼쪽 열', right_on = '오른쪽 열', how = '조인방식' ) left : 왼쪽 데이터프레임 right : 오른쪽 … Spletpred toliko dnevi: 2 · I would like to get a dataframe of counts from a pandas pivot table, but for the aggregate function to include every index. For example df1 = pd.DataFrame({"A": ["foo", "ba... restaurants near pittsburgh pa airport https://martinwilliamjones.com

pandas.DataFrameを結合するmerge, join(列・インデックス基準)

Splet10. apr. 2016 · You can do this with merge: df_merged = df1.merge (df2, how='outer', left_index=True, right_index=True) The keyword argument how='outer' keeps all indices … Splet谢谢你发布这个问题。 它促使我花了几个小时来研究merge_asof的来源,很有教育意义。我不认为你的解决方案可以得到很大的改进,但我想提供一些调整,使其速度加快几个百 … SpletMerge DataFrame or named Series objects with a database-style join. A named Series object is treated as a DataFrame with a single named column. The join is done on … prowax filters

pyspark.pandas.DataFrame.merge — PySpark 3.4.0 documentation

Category:How to Merge Two Pandas DataFrames on Index

Tags:Pd merge pandas on index

Pd merge pandas on index

merge several dataframes with different column names

SpletIn some use cases, this is the fastest choice. Especially if there are many groups and the function passed to groupby is not optimized. An example is to find the mode of each group; groupby.transform is over twice as slow. df = pd.DataFrame({'group': pd.Index(range(1000)).repeat(1000), 'value': np.random.default_rng().choice(10, … Spletpred toliko dnevi: 2 · I am not able to do it using reduce function as b column is not named similarly in all dataframes. I need to create merge based on a, b type columns. Then retain a type column name for once, and then all b type column names. Is there any possible way to do it. import pandas as pd from functools import reduce # create sample dataframes df1 …

Pd merge pandas on index

Did you know?

Splet27. avg. 2024 · How to Merge Two Pandas DataFrames on Index df1.join(df2). By default, this performs an inner join. pd.merge(df1, df2, left_index=True, right_index=True). By … Splet04. avg. 2024 · pd.merge (), pd.DataFrame.merge ()の基本的な使い方 pd.merge () 関数では第一引数 left と第二引数 right に結合する2つの pandas.DataFrame を指定する。 …

Splet20. mar. 2024 · merge的默认合并方法: merge用于表内部基于 index-on-index 和 index-on-column (s) 的合并,但默认是基于index来合并。 1 2 1.1 复合key的合并方法 使用merge的时候可以选择多个key作为复合可以来对齐合并。 1 1.1.1 通过on指定数据合并对齐的列 In [41]: left = pd.DataFrame ( {'key1': ['K0', 'K0', 'K1', 'K2'], ....: 'key2': ['K0', 'K1', 'K0', 'K1'], ....: 'A': ['A0', … SpletDefinition and Usage. The merge () method updates the content of two DataFrame by merging them together, using the specified method (s). Use the parameters to control …

Splet15. mar. 2024 · Note that you can also use pd.merge() with the following syntax to return the exact same result: #perform left join pd. merge (df1, df2, on=' team ', how=' left ') team … SpletBoth the dataframes are merged on index using default Inner Join. By this way we basically merged the dataframes by index and also kept the index as it is in merged dataframe. Merge two Dataframes on index of one dataframe and some column of other dataframe

SpletObject to merge with. how{‘left’, ‘right’, ‘outer’, ‘inner’, ‘cross’}, default ‘inner’. Type of merge to be performed. left: use only keys from left frame, similar to a SQL left outer join; preserve …

SpletMerge DataFrames by indexes or columns. Notes The keys, levels, and names arguments are all optional. A walkthrough of how this method fits in with other tools for combining pandas objects can be found here. It is not recommended to build DataFrames by adding single rows in a for loop. Build a list of rows and make a DataFrame in a single concat. restaurants near pittsford nySpletSteps to implement Pandas Merge on Index Step 1: Import the required libraries Here I am using only NumPy, DateTime, and pandas libraries for dataframe creation and merging. Let’s import all of them. import numpy as np impot pandas as pd import datatime Step 2: Create Dataframes For the implementation part, We require two dataframes. prowax filters for oticon hearing aidsSplet11. apr. 2024 · A Tip A Day Python Tip 6 Pandas Merge Dev Skrol. A Tip A Day Python Tip 6 Pandas Merge Dev Skrol Use pandas.concat (). it takes a list of dataframes, and appends … restaurants near plymouth mann theaterSpletIn some use cases, this is the fastest choice. Especially if there are many groups and the function passed to groupby is not optimized. An example is to find the mode of each … restaurants near playa linda arubaSpletThe MultiIndex object is the hierarchical analogue of the standard Index object which typically stores the axis labels in pandas objects. You can think of MultiIndex as an array … prowax for hearing aidsrestaurants near playhouse theatre londonSpletWrite the merged DataFrame to a new CSV file: merged_df.to_csv ('merged_file.csv', index=False) Python The index=False parameter specifies that the row index should not be included in the output file. Optionally, you can also use the merge method instead of concat if you want to merge DataFrames based on a common column. Here’s an example: pro wax mini filters